Mendukung beberapa instance UI Edge

Edge for Private Cloud v. 4.17.09

Anda dapat menginstal beberapa instance UI Edge dalam skenario ketersediaan tinggi. Namun, setelah menginstal dua instance UI Edge, Anda harus melakukan tugas pasca-penginstalan untuk menyinkronkan setelan properti di antara keduanya.

Secara khusus, Anda harus mengonfigurasi dua instance UI agar memiliki nilai yang sama untuk properti berikut:

application.secret=value
mail.smtp.credential=value
apigee.mgmt.credential=value

Selain itu, jika mengonfigurasinya untuk menggunakan TLS, Anda harus memastikan bahwa Anda menggunakan sertifikat dan kunci yang sama di kedua instance.

Mengonfigurasi instance UI Edge menggunakan HTTP

  1. Login ke node yang menghosting instance UI Edge pertama (jangan login ke UI itu sendiri, melainkan sebagai pengguna pada node).
  2. Buka /opt/apigee/edge-ui/conf/apigee.conf di editor dan salin nilai properti berikut untuk digunakan nanti:
    mail.smtp.credential="value"
    apigee.mgmt.credential="value"
  3. Buka /opt/apigee/edge-ui/conf/application.conf di editor dan salin nilai properti berikut untuk digunakan nanti:
    application.secret="value"
  4. Login ke node yang menghosting instance UI Edge kedua.
  5. Buka /opt/apigee/customer/application/ui.properties pada instance UI kedua di editor. Jika file tidak ada, buat file tersebut.
  6. Tambahkan properti berikut ke /opt/apigee/customer/application/ui.properties, termasuk nilai yang Anda salin dari instance UI pertama:
    conf_application_application.secret="value"
    conf_apigee_mail.smtp.credential="value"
    conf_apigee_apigee

    kredensial "

  7. Simpan file.
  8. Pastikan /opt/apigee/customer/application/ui.properties dimiliki oleh pengguna apigee:
    > chown apigee:apigee /opt/apigee/customer/application/ui.properties
  9. Mulai ulang instance UI kedua:
    > /opt/apigee/apigee-service/bin/apigee-service edge-ui restart

Pengguna kini dapat login ke salah satu instance UI.

Mengonfigurasi instance UI Edge menggunakan TLS/HTTPS

  1. Konfigurasikan instance UI pertama untuk menggunakan TLS/HTTPS seperti yang dijelaskan dalam Mengonfigurasi TLS untuk UI pengelolaan.
  2. Konfigurasikan instance UI Edge kedua seperti yang dijelaskan di atas agar HTTP menyinkronkan properti yang diperlukan.
  3. Salin file JKS yang berisi sertifikat dan kunci dari instance UI pertama ke node yang menghosting instance UI kedua.
  4. Konfigurasikan instance UI kedua untuk menggunakan TLS/HTTPS seperti yang dijelaskan dalam Mengonfigurasi TLS untuk UI pengelolaan.